Team Israel Premier Tech 's Michael Woods crosses the finish line during Stage 13 of the Vuelta a Espana, a 176-kilometre race between Lugo and Puerto de Ancares, on Aug. 30.The 37-year-old from Ottawa rides into this weekend’s Montreal cycling Grand Prix as a recent Spanish Vuelta stage winner despite dealing with an early-season illness that had him struggling at the Giro d’Italia and considering calling it quits.

After months of re-finding his stamina, Woods, who became the third Canadian to win a Tour de France stage last year, triumphed on the mountainous 13th stage of La Vuelta on Aug. 30. It was his third career win in Spain. With a stage win in hand, Woods pulled out of the Vuelta before the 17th stage and shifted his focus to preparing for Montreal as a late addition to the start list.

Meanwhile, Montreal’s race covers 209.1 kilometres over 17 laps.
